Consortiums land $1.16bn BESS Saudi projects

0/0
The four BESS projects will deliver a combined storage capacity of 2,000 MW for four hours

A consortium comprising Saudi Energy, Acwa Power and Al Sharif Contracting and Commercial Development Company has been awarded three of four 500-MW each battery energy storage system (BESS) projects worth a total investment of over SAR4.35 billion ($1.16 billion)  in Saudi Arabia.

Under the deal signed by the Saudi Power Procurement Company (SPPC), the principal buyer, the four projects will deliver a combined storage capacity of 2,000 MW for four hours, equivalent to 8,000 MWh of energy storage capacity.

The three projects being developed by Saudi Energy, Acwa Power and Al Sharif Contracting and Commercial Development Company consortium include the Al Muwyah and Haden BESS ISPs in the Makkah Region, and the Al Kahafa BESS ISP in the Hail Region.

Meanwhile, a consortium comprising Engie and Haji Abdullah Alireza & Company will develop the Al Khushaybi BESS ISP project in the Qassim Region.

The scope of the four projects includes the development, financing, construction, ownership, operation and maintenance of large-scale battery energy storage facilities under the build-own-operate (BOO) model.

The projects will store electricity for up to four hours and dispatch power when required, supporting grid stability, improving operational flexibility and enhancing the security and reliability of electricity supply across the Kingdom.

The agreements were signed in the presence of Prince Abdulaziz bin Salman bin Abdulaziz, Minister of Energy, who also serves as Minister of Industry and Mineral Resources and Chairman of the Board of Managers of SPPC.

The BESS facilities are expected to play a key role in supporting the Kingdom’s target of achieving an optimal electricity generation mix comprising approximately 50 per cent renewable energy by 2030, while meeting growing electricity demand and reducing the need for conventional generation during periods of peak demand.
